Job Description
The Finance Officer is responsible for the financial management, reporting, and regulatory compliance of the Securities Dealer. The role ensures accurate and timely preparation of financial statements, monitoring of capital adequacy, and adherence to all FSA reporting obligations under the Securities Act and related regulations.
Key Responsibilities
- Prepare monthly, quarterly, and annual financial statements in accordance with International Financial Reporting Standards (IFRS).
- Maintain accurate accounting records, general ledger reconciliations, and supporting schedules.
- Oversee accounts payable, receivable, payroll, and bank reconciliations.
- Monitor and report on the firm’s financial performance, liquidity, and capital adequacy ratios as required by the FSA.
- Prepare and submit statutory filings and regulatory returns to the Board of Directors and relevant regulatory authorities within prescribed deadlines.
- Assist in annual audits and liaise with external auditors to ensure smooth completion of the audit process.
- Support management with budgeting, financial forecasting, and cost analysis.
- Implement and maintain internal financial controls and ensure compliance with company policies and procedures.
- Ensure proper documentation and record-keeping for all financial transactions.
- Contribute to process automation and system improvements for efficiency and transparency.

Job Requirements
- Bachelor’s degree in Accounting, Finance, or a related field; professional qualification (ACCA, CPA, or equivalent) preferred.
- Minimum 1 years’ accounting or finance experience in the financial services or securities sector.
- Strong analytical and problem-solving skills with attention to detail.
- Proficiency in accounting software (e.g., QuickBooks, Xero) and Microsoft Excel.
- Excellent communication and organizational skills.
